Output 134c30314128275e5d7222bac13cfb3a4bdb9f7c2c07509e223cba9d3e306499:117

value
4350616603
script pubkey
OP_0 OP_PUSHBYTES_20 d38a07d4afb2771c47c41d9c8fab9ed421377353
address
bc1q6w9q0490kfm3c37yrkwgl2u76ssnwu6nazc7f7
transaction
134c30314128275e5d7222bac13cfb3a4bdb9f7c2c07509e223cba9d3e306499
spent
true